Explore the picturesque camping options near South Harwich, MA, where the charm of Cape Cod meets the serenity of the great outdoors. For RV enthusiasts, Cape Cod RV Resort offers spacious, full-hookup sites nestled among shady trees, with convenient access to local beaches and bike trails. If you prefer a more intimate experience, Nickerson State Park provides designated tent camping spots surrounded by tranquil ponds and lush forests. This park is a haven for nature lovers, offering hiking trails and accessible freshwater lakes for swimming and canoeing. For the adventurous spirit, dispersed camping is permitted in select areas of Cape Cod National Seashore, allowing for a unique and secluded experience close to the region's renowned coastal landscapes. Whether you're in an RV, pitching a tent, or seeking a remote getaway, South Harwich’s camping options deliver unforgettable experiences amid Cape Cod's stunning geography.
